Professional Background

Morgen Stanzler is a dedicated global public health professional whose career spans over several years in project management and public health consultancy, particularly in low and middle-income countries. With extensive experience at the Institute for Healthcare Improvement (IHI), Morgen has honed a robust skill set that encompasses both leadership and collaboration in diverse health scenarios. In her role as Senior Project Manager at IHI, she has successfully led various projects aimed at improving health outcomes and ensuring effective program delivery. Morgen's commitment to quality improvement is evident in her hands-on approach to data collection and analysis, which she utilizes to inform health strategies and devise innovative solutions to complex public health challenges.

Morgen began her journey in public health as a Graduate Research Assistant at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, where she supported research initiatives that helped shape her understanding of public health dynamics. Her tenure as a Public Health Consultant for both the Orange County Solid Waste Management and the Haitian American Caucus further solidified her expertise in addressing health issues through targeted interventions and community engagement. These roles have equipped her with valuable insights into the socio-economic factors influencing health outcomes in diverse populations.

Education and Achievements

Morgen Stanzler's education reflects a strong foundation in the social sciences and public health. She earned a Bachelor of Arts in Political Science and Government from the prestigious University of Florida. This academic background laid the groundwork for her analytical skills and understanding of policy, governance, and their critical roles in shaping public health initiatives.

Continuing her pursuit of knowledge, Morgen obtained a Master's degree in Public Health from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, where she further developed her competencies in health systems, epidemiology, and community-based health improvement strategies.
